Computes log softmax activations.
For each batch `i` and class `j` we have
logsoftmax[i, j] = logits[i, j] - log(sum(exp(logits[i])))

public Output<T> asOutput ()
Returns the symbolic handle of the tensor.
Inputs to TensorFlow operations are outputs of another TensorFlow operation. This method is used to obtain a symbolic handle that represents the computation of the input.
public static LogSoftmax<T> create (Scope scope, Operand<T> logits)
Factory method to create a class wrapping a new LogSoftmax operation.
Parameters
scope | current scope |
---|---|
logits | 2-D with shape `[batch_size, num_classes]`. |
Returns
- a new instance of LogSoftmax
